The Top Benefits of Vehicle Tracking Systems
1. Real-time GPS tracking & fleet visibility
- Get live location updates on all vehicles in your fleet.
- Improve route planning and reduce delivery delays.
- Minimise downtime by identifying the nearest vehicle for urgent jobs.
2. Reduced fuel costs & efficient route planning
- Optimise routes to reduce unnecessary mileage and fuel wastage.
- Monitor fuel consumption and identify inefficient driving habits.
- Minimise idling time to cut fuel expenses.
3. Improved driver safety & behaviour monitoring
- Track your employees speeding, harsh braking, and cornering.
- Provide driver scorecards for coaching and training.
- Ensure compliance with road safety regulations.
4. Enhanced security & theft prevention
- Get instant alerts for unauthorised vehicle use or unexpected movements.
- Geofencing capabilities allow you to set virtual boundaries.
- You can rest assured with quick recovery of stolen vehicles with GPS tracking.
5. Lower insurance premiums
- Did you know that many insurance providers offer discounts for businesses using GPS tracking?
- This can help to reduce the risk of theft and improved driver behaviour lowers claim rates.
- Enhance fleet compliance to meet insurance requirements.
6. Automated compliance & HMRC mileage tracking
- Generate automated reports for tax compliance and fuel expenses.
- Ensure compliance with working time regulations and duty-of-care policies.
- Reduce the nagging administrative burden with auto-logging mileage and driver hours.
7. Improved customer service & delivery performance
- Provide accurate delivery time estimates to your customers.
- Reduce missed appointments with automated alerts.
- Therefore you can enhance customer trust with real-time order tracking.
8. Reduced maintenance costs & fleet longevity
- Set up automated alerts for things like servicing, MOT renewals, and repairs.
- Reduce unexpected breakdowns (therefore avoiding costly emergency repairs!)
- Track vehicle wear and tear β this can extend fleet lifespan.
